  • 5/5 Tips From A B. 2 years ago on Google
    Simply Southern Smokehouse in Myrtle Beach , South Carolina was so good and only $12 ! The employees were nice and the bus boy would clean the tables and bust out in song . He sang Lynard Skynard -Simple Man , really good . Chicken Bog , Carolina Pulled Pork , rib , hush puppies , mashed potatoes and gravy , corn , banana pudding and apple cobbler . Yummm ! Go try it when you visit Myrtle Beach on Mr Joe White Avenue . I made it here about 30 minutes before closing on October 8th and they were nice enough to let me in unlike some businesses that cut off before that . There were a couple other tables with people still there so I didn't feel like I was the only one there . They told me to take my time and eat what I wanted and they wouldn't remove the food from the line till everyone had their fill and was ready to go . I made a full plate the first time and a half plate for seconds . When I left there was still one couple there who left shortly after me . The bus boy was so nice and we talked a little . Now the food ! The fried chicken was so good . I got a nice sized chicken breast and it was cooked just right with good battered skin . Carolina pulled pork was good with a hint of the vinegar based sauce , but they also had it on the table so I added more to give it more of a kick . Chicken bog was good , but didn't have a lot of chicken in it , but lots of sausage . The bus boy said people a lot of times get all the chicken out of it and I can always ask to have them add more chicken to it . It was way better than the place I had it at the next day . The rib was just okay , but meaty . Mashed potatoes and gravy were spot on and the hush puppies were nice and moist inside . The corn was just okay . Banana pudding was creamy and good and the cobbler was really really good . I would definitely recommend coming here . If I would have been in town longer I would have definitely came back for dinner again . The place is clean , the employees are great , and the atmosphere is very nice . The outside looks like a big country house . One of the best meals I had in my 2 weeks in the Carolinas .
